The Importance of Networking
Networking involves building relationships with others in your field or area of interest. It provides opportunities to learn, share ideas, and gain support. Effective networking can lead to new career opportunities, collaborations, and access to valuable resources.
Benefits of Networking
- Expanding professional contacts
- Gaining new insights and knowledge
- Discovering opportunities for growth
- Building confidence and communication skills
Successful networkers are often more adaptable and better prepared to face challenges. They also tend to be more innovative, as exposure to diverse perspectives sparks creativity.
The Role of Mentorship
Mentorship involves a more experienced individual guiding a less experienced person. Mentors provide advice, support, and encouragement, helping mentees navigate their personal and professional journeys.
Benefits of Mentorship
- Gaining valuable insights and knowledge
- Receiving constructive feedback
- Building confidence and resilience
- Expanding professional networks through mentor connections
Mentorship fosters a culture of continuous learning and personal development. It helps individuals set achievable goals and develop strategies to reach them.
Synergy Between Networking and Mentorship
When combined, networking and mentorship create a powerful synergy for personal growth. Networking can lead to mentorship opportunities, and mentors often expand their mentees’ networks. Together, they inspire motivation, accountability, and lifelong learning.
Practical Tips for Building Your Network and Finding Mentors
- Attend industry events and conferences
- Join professional organizations and online communities
- Be proactive in reaching out to potential mentors
- Offer value to your contacts and mentors
- Maintain relationships through regular communication
Remember, building meaningful relationships takes time and genuine effort. Stay open, curious, and committed to your personal growth journey.
